Driverless in Dubai: WeRide's robotaxis go fully commercial

Since the end of March 2026, fully driverless WeRide robotaxis carry paying passengers in Jumeirah and Umm Suqeim.

Dubai's autonomous-mobility plans reached a commercial milestone in 2026. After receiving a driverless vehicle permit in February, WeRide launched fully driverless commercial robotaxi operations on 31 March 2026, running routes in Jumeirah and Umm Suqeim with vehicles supplied through Jameel Motors.

What changed

Earlier autonomous trials in the UAE kept a safety driver behind the wheel. This deployment removes that seat for commercial rides on approved routes — a shift from testing to a paid, public service operating under RTA oversight.
